ArcGIS MapReduce:模板挂接与地图制作流程
需积分: 28 96 浏览量
更新于2024-08-09
收藏 1.5MB PDF 举报
"ArcGIS地图模板挂接及MapReduce详细流程"
在GIS领域,ArcGIS是一款广泛使用的专业地理信息系统,尤其在数据管理和地图制作方面表现出色。本文主要关注如何在ArcMap中挂接地图模板以及MapReduce在处理大数据时的详细流程。
首先,让我们详细了解一下在ArcGIS中挂接地图模板的过程。地图模板是预先设定好的地图布局,包含了地图的图层、样式、比例尺等元素,便于快速创建和编辑地图。以下是挂接地图模板的步骤:
1. 使用ArcMap打开地图模板:启动ArcMap应用程序,通过“文件”菜单选择“打开”,然后找到并加载地图模板文件(.mxt)。
2. 修复数据源:在地图界面中,右键点击任意一个带有红色惊叹号的地图图层,这表示数据源可能存在问题。在弹出的菜单中选择“数据”然后点击“修复数据源”。
3. 选择要素类:在接下来的数据源对话框中,浏览并选择图层对应的实际数据库要素类。这确保了图层正确连接到其数据源,红色惊叹号会消失,表明模板已成功挂接。
接下来,我们转向MapReduce,这是处理大数据的一种分布式计算模型。在Hadoop生态系统中,MapReduce主要用于对大规模数据集进行并行处理。其工作流程包括两个主要阶段:
1. Map阶段:这个阶段将输入数据集分割成多个小块,每个块被分配到集群中的不同节点进行处理。Map函数接收键值对作为输入,执行特定的逻辑操作,然后产生新的中间键值对。
2. Reduce阶段:中间键值对由系统排序并分组,然后传递给Reduce函数。Reduce函数负责聚合这些数据,执行汇总、统计或其他复杂的操作,最终产生输出结果。
ArcGIS与MapReduce的结合可以用于处理地理空间大数据,例如,分析遥感图像、地理编码大量地址或执行空间统计。用户可以通过ArcGIS的Geoprocessing工具链或者ArcGIS for Hadoop来实现这种集成。
总结来说,ArcGIS提供了强大的地图模板功能,方便用户快速创建和更新地图。同时,通过MapReduce,我们可以处理海量地理数据,进行复杂的空间分析。这两者结合,为地理信息系统领域的数据管理和分析提供了高效的方法。无论是为了制图还是构建地理数据库,ArcGIS都能提供一套完整的解决方案。
2022-05-01 上传
2022-04-19 上传
2021-06-20 上传
2021-06-14 上传
2011-11-19 上传
2018-11-22 上传
2021-05-01 上传
菊果子
- 粉丝: 51
- 资源: 3764
最新资源
- Elasticsearch核心改进:实现Translog与索引线程分离
- 分享个人Vim与Git配置文件管理经验
- 文本动画新体验:textillate插件功能介绍
- Python图像处理库Pillow 2.5.2版本发布
- DeepClassifier:简化文本分类任务的深度学习库
- Java领域恩舒技术深度解析
- 渲染jquery-mentions的markdown-it-jquery-mention插件
- CompbuildREDUX:探索Minecraft的现实主义纹理包
- Nest框架的入门教程与部署指南
- Slack黑暗主题脚本教程:简易安装指南
- JavaScript开发进阶:探索develop-it-master项目
- SafeStbImageSharp:提升安全性与代码重构的图像处理库
- Python图像处理库Pillow 2.5.0版本发布
- mytest仓库功能测试与HTML实践
- MATLAB与Python对比分析——cw-09-jareod源代码探究
- KeyGenerator工具:自动化部署节点密钥生成